【$.ajax返回的JSON无法执行success的解决方法】教程文章相关的互联网学习教程文章

ajaxpro.dll 控件实现异步刷新页面

html代码 复制代码 代码如下:<script type="text/javascript"><!-- function getUserName() { Demo.ajax.GetUserName(document.getElementById("accout").value,getName); } function getName(respone) { document.getElementById("passowrd").value=respone.value; } // --></script> </head> <body> <form id="form1" runat="server"> <div> <p>帐号:<input id="accout" type="text" onchange="getUserName()" /></p> <p>用户名...

Ajax实现异步操作实例_针对XML格式的请求数据【代码】

js分类中有一节【原生js异步请求,XML解析】主要说明了js前台是如何处理XML格式请求和如何接受由服务器返回的XML数据的解析,今天我将用一个实例来说明具体要如何操作.前台的参数类型也是XML使用的是jquery:123456789101112131415161718192021 function test(){ var xmlString ="<bookstore>"+ "<book Type=‘必修课‘ ISBN=‘7-111-19149-2‘>"+ "<title>数据结构</title>"+ ...

jQuery AJAX 网页无刷新上传示例【代码】【图】

新年礼,提供简单、易套用的 jQuery AJAX 上传示例及代码下载。后台对文件的上传及检查,以 C#/.NET Handler 处理 (可视需要改写成 Java 或 PHP)。有时做一个网站项目 (不论是否 ASP.NET),内附的 FileUpload 控件,功能不足 (页面必须刷新、不支援 AJAX),或外观太丑被用户嫌弃 (却无法透过 CSS 自定义外观)。网路上虽已有许多可用的示例,如: jQuery File Upload,但功能太强大、外观复杂,欲仅取出部分功能来引用,反而不易。因...

ajax使用时的事项

1.post和get方法只能传递json对象,ajax方法可以传递json对象或者json字符串2.在后台需要{studentIds:[1,2,3],userIds:[1,2,3]}这样的数据时,需要将数据转化为字符串:JSON.stringify(data),----拓展:JSON.parse(str);---将字符串转为json对象别忘了加上contentType : "application/json", 后台srpringmvc接收参数: @requestbody(解析json字符串) JsonObject idsArr 原文:https://www.cnblogs.com/cg961107/p/10848444.html

ajax教程完整版

第 1 页 Ajax 简介Ajax 由 HTML、JavaScript? 技术、DHTML 和 DOM 组成,这一杰出的方法可以将笨拙的 Web 界面转化成交互性的 Ajax 应用程序。本文的作者是一位 Ajax 专家,他演示了这些技术如何协同工作 —— 从总体概述到细节的讨论 —— 使高效的 Web 开发成为现实。他还揭开了 Ajax 核心概念的神秘面纱,包括 XMLHttpRequest 对象。五年前,如果不知道 XML,您就是一只无人重视的丑小鸭。十八个月前,Ruby 成了关注的中心,不知...

Javascript Ajax总结——其他跨域技术之Comet【代码】

Comet指一种更高级的Ajax技术( 也称 “服务器推送” ),一种服务器向页面推送数据的技术。Comet能够让信息近乎实时地被推送到页面上,非常适合体育比赛的分数和股票报价。有两种实现Comet的方式:长轮询、流传统轮询(也称短轮询),即浏览器定时向服务器发送请求,看有没有更新的数据。长轮询把短轮询颠倒了一下。页面发起一个到服务器的新请求,然后服务器一直保持连接打开,直到有数据可发送。发送完数据之后,浏览器关闭连接...

PHP判断一个请求是AJAX请求还是普通请求

首先说说原理:在发送ajax请求的时候,我们可以通过XMLHttpRequest这个对象,创建自定义的header头信息如果您使用的是原生的ajax方法,也就是未使用jquery或者其他js框架包装的ajax方法,那么代码如下:?1xmlHttpRequest.setRequestHeader("request_type","ajax");哦~对了,您一定知道xmlHttpRequest这个对象是怎么创建的吧?额?您没开玩笑吧?您不知道–那我劝您还是不要了解了,放心吧~您对他不了解也没事,下面我来告诉你怎么在...

SpringMVC经典系列-13使用SpringMVC处理Ajax请求---【LinusZhu】

注意:此文章是个人原创,希望有转载需要的朋友们标明文章出处,如果各位朋友们觉得写的还好,就给个赞哈,你的鼓励是我创作的最大动力,LinusZhu在此表示十分感谢,当然文章中如有纰漏,请联系linuszhu@163.com,敬请朋友们斧正,谢谢。 这一部分主要讲解SpringMVC如何处理Ajax请求,是首先要讲解一下jackson类库,可以帮助我们在java对象和json、xml数据之间的互相转换。他可以将控制器返回的对象直接转换成json数据,供客户...

原生ajax【代码】【图】

概述:原生Ajax实现使用的是系统内置的构造函数XMLHttpRequest()<script type="text/javascript"> var p=document.getElementsByTagName(‘p‘)[0]; if(window.XMLHttpRequest){var xhr=new XMLHttpRequest(); }else{var xhr=new ActiveXObject(‘msxml2.0.XMLHTTP‘); } xhr.onreadystatechange=function(){if(xhr.readyState==4){if(xhr.status==200||xhr.status==304){p.innerHTML=xhr.responseText;}}} xhr.open(‘get‘,‘./r...

formData + ajax +springMVC实现文件上传【代码】【图】

实际开发过程中经常会遇到这样的需求,文件上传,但不需要表单提交,这里可以通过formData来实现参考资料:http://yunzhu.iteye.com/blog/2177923http://www.jianshu.com/p/46e6e03a0d53//需要支持多文件上传的需要添加multiple 属性<input type="file" class="update_btn excel_btn" multiple />js代码如下<!-- 用于上传文件 ,可实现同时上传过个文件--   后台处理代码如下: /** 实现同时上传多个文件* MultipartFile[] files...

javascript-ajax学习【图】

/** * @todo 封装Ajax 传输类 * @param params:参数 * @example 用法: var mAjaxer = new Ajaxer(parames);mAjaxer.send(); */(function (window,undefined) { var defined = {}, rtrim = /^(\s|\u00A0)+|(\s|\u00A0)+$/g; defined.trim = function( text ) { return (text || "").replace( rtrim, "" ); }; defined.parseJSON = function(data,error) { if ( typeof data !...

ASP.NET 使用Ajax(转)【代码】【图】

之前在Ajax初步理解中介绍了对Ajax的初步理解,本文将介绍在ASP.NET中如何方便使用Ajax,第一种当然是使用jQuery的ajax,功能强大而且操作简单方便,第二种是使用.NET封装好的ScriptManager。$.ajax向普通页面发送get请求这是最简单的一种方式了,先简单了解jQuery ajax的语法,最常用的调用方式是这样:$.ajax({settings}); 有几个常用的setting,全部参数及其解释可以去jQuery官方API文档查询1. type:请求方式 get/post2. url:请...

ajax笔记【代码】

Ajax:Aysnchronous Javascript and xml(异步JS和XML技术)1. Ajax是什么(数据交互)是指一种创建交互式网页应用的网页开发技术 京东 的用户名验证 严选网站的新品首发,商品原先是8个,点击之后数量增加 简书 当浏览器滚动的时候,在底部追加新的文章点击”阅读更多“的时候,在底部追加新文章共同的特点:页面没有刷新,但是得到了网站服务器上最新的数据(新用户明是否注册,严选商品数量增加,简书文章数据增加)上述功能的实现...

jquery +ajax 上传加预览【代码】

<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>Title</title></head><body><script src="/static/jquery-1.12.4.js"></script><h3>4.文件上传</h3> <input type="file" id="img" /> <div id="container"></div> <a class="btn" onclick="AjaxSubmit6()">上传</a><script>function AjaxSubmit6() { //document.getElementById(‘img‘)[0] var data = new FormData()...

JQuery 的Ajax的使用【代码】

JSON:一种轻量级的数据表示方法,优点:传输方便,占用字节少XML:一种偏重量级的数据表示方法,优点:格式清晰,占用字节多,大量的字节都浪费在了标签上; 网络传输我们常使用json,因为浏览器解析方便;服务器可以利用json工具(比如:fastjson,gson)等快速的将json和java对象进行互转;一个简单的json格式数据 {“name”:”tom”,”age”:18}如果上面的数据用xml。可以这么表示 <user> <name>tom</name> ...